Helmi

2. 소프트웨어 개발 - EAI 본문

정보처리기사/필기

2. 소프트웨어 개발 - EAI

Helmi 2023. 5. 12. 16:13

EAI (Enterprise Applicationn Integration)

- 기업 내 각종 애플리케이션 및 플랫폼 간의 정보 전달, 연계, 통합 등 상호 연동 가능하게 해주는 솔루션

 

EAI 구축 유형

- Point-to-Point : 가장 기본적인 애플리케이션 통합 방식, 애플리케이션을 1:1로 연결하며 변경 및 재사용 어려움

- Hub & Spoke : 단일 접점인 허브 시스템 통해 데이터 전송하는 중앙 집중형 방식, 확장 및 유지 보수가 용이하나 허브 장애 발생 시 시스템 전체에 영향 미침

- Message & Bus(ESB 방식) : 애플리케이션 사이에 미들웨어 두어 처리하는 방식. 확장성 뛰어나며 대용량 처리 가능

- Hybrid : Hub & Spoke와 Message Bus의 혼합 방식. 그룹 내에서는 Hub&Spoke 방식을, 그룹 간에는 Message Bus 방식 사용